Summary
Denial of Service (DoS) in HashiCorp Consul
Details
HashiCorp Consul and Consul Enterprise up to 1.6.2 HTTP/RPC services allowed unbounded resource usage, and were susceptible to unauthenticated denial of service. Fixed in 1.6.3.
Specific Go Packages Affected
github.com/hashicorp/consul/agent/consul
